如何制作单机游戏,从概念到发布的全流程指南怎么制作单机游戏修改器,如何制作并发布单机游戏,全流程指南及修改器制作

admin92025-06-01 00:43:30
制作单机游戏是一个涉及多个步骤和工具的过程,你需要确定游戏的概念和玩法,并设计游戏的世界观、角色和故事情节,使用游戏引擎(如Unity或Unreal Engine)创建游戏原型,并编写游戏脚本和代码,在开发过程中,可以使用各种工具和插件来优化游戏体验,如物理引擎、音效库和UI工具,完成开发后,进行游戏测试,修复漏洞和错误,发布游戏并推广,可以使用各种平台(如Steam、PlayStation等)进行发布,还可以制作游戏修改器来增强游戏体验,这需要了解游戏引擎的脚本系统和开发工具,制作单机游戏需要耐心、创造力和技术知识。

在数字娱乐的广阔领域中,单机游戏以其独特的魅力吸引着无数玩家沉浸于虚拟世界,体验冒险、解谜、策略等多样化的乐趣,对于想要踏入这一领域的游戏开发者而言,从创意萌芽到游戏发布,每一步都充满了挑战与机遇,本文将详细介绍如何制作一款单机游戏,涵盖策划、设计、编程、美术、音效及发布等关键环节,旨在帮助有志于成为游戏开发者的你,迈出坚实的第一步。

前期准备:概念与策划

灵感收集
一切始于一个想法,通过阅读书籍、观看电影、体验其他游戏或参与游戏社区讨论,寻找灵感,记录下任何可能的游戏概念,无论多么微小或荒诞。

市场调研
研究当前市场趋势,了解同类游戏的优缺点,确定目标玩家群体,以及你的游戏如何与众不同,这有助于明确游戏类型、风格及核心玩法。

原型设计
基于收集到的信息和市场调研结果,开始制作一个简单的游戏原型,这可以是纸笔草图、流程图或是非常基础的数字原型,目的是验证游戏概念是否可行。

游戏设计

剧本与故事板
为游戏编写一个吸引人的故事,包括角色设定、情节发展、对话等,使用故事板工具将关键场景可视化,帮助团队成员理解游戏流程。

游戏机制设计
定义游戏规则、目标、挑战及玩家互动方式,考虑如何平衡难度,确保游戏既有趣又不至于让玩家感到沮丧。

界面与交互设计
设计直观易用的用户界面(UI)和用户体验(UX),确保玩家能轻松掌握控制,享受游戏过程。

编程实现

选择工具与引擎
根据团队技术栈和游戏需求选择合适的编程语言和游戏引擎(如Unity、Unreal Engine、Godot等),这些工具能极大提高开发效率。

分工协作
组建一个跨职能团队,包括程序员、美术设计师、音效师等,采用敏捷开发方法,如Scrum或Kanban,确保高效协作。

编程实现

  • 程序员负责游戏逻辑、角色控制、关卡设计、物理模拟等。
  • 美术师负责角色建模、场景绘制、动画等。
  • 音效师负责背景音乐、音效设计,增强游戏氛围。

测试与迭代
定期进行内部测试,收集反馈并快速迭代,使用版本控制系统(如Git)管理代码变更,保持项目可追踪性。

美术与音效制作

美术风格选择
根据游戏概念选择适合的美术风格,如写实、卡通、像素艺术等,确保风格统一且符合目标玩家群体的审美偏好。

角色与场景设计
创建高质量的角色模型和场景,注重细节和表现力,利用贴图、光影效果提升视觉体验。

音效与音乐
制作或采购合适的音效和背景音乐,增强游戏的沉浸感,注意音效的时机和音量控制,避免干扰游戏体验。

发布与宣传

平台选择
决定在哪些平台上发布游戏(PC、主机、移动设备等),并了解各平台的特定要求。

提交审核
根据所选平台的要求,准备必要的文档和素材,提交审核申请,注意遵守各平台的政策和指南。

营销与推广
利用社交媒体、博客、论坛等渠道进行宣传,制作吸引人的预告片、截图和宣传文案,考虑与KOL或社区合作,扩大影响力。

用户反馈与优化
发布后积极收集用户反馈,根据反馈进行必要的更新和优化,提升游戏体验,考虑推出DLC或续作,持续吸引玩家。

制作单机游戏是一个既充满挑战又极具成就感的过程,它要求开发者具备创意、技术实力以及良好的团队协作能力,从概念构想到最终发布,每一步都需精心策划与执行,随着技术的不断进步和市场的日益成熟,越来越多的独立开发者正通过这一途径实现自己的梦想,创造出令人惊叹的作品,如果你对游戏开发充满热情,不妨从现在开始行动,用你的创意和技术为这个世界带来更多乐趣与惊喜吧!

文章下方广告位

相关文章